Chetnole train station operates on a more modest scale compared to some of the bustling city termini. While you won't find a ticket office or even a ticket machine for collection at Chetnole, the station is equipped with an induction loop for those with hearing impairments. Keep in mind that due to its small size, facilities such as waiting rooms, accessible toilets, and baby changing areas are not available. If assistance is needed, a help point is available, ensuring you can reach out for information and support on your journey.
If you're traveling by bicycle, Chetnole accommodates with stands suitable for storing four cycles. Although these aren't sheltered or covered by CCTV, cycling remains a convenient and eco-friendly option for arriving at or departing from the station.

Millbrook (Hants) station is quite modest in terms of facilities. There's no traditional ticket office or ticket machines available, which means the purchase and collection of tickets must be done in advance online, or you can utilize the Permit to Travel machine. This machine requires you to exchange your purchased permit for a ticket on the train itself. An induction loop is available, and while there is no waiting room, seating area, or first-class lounge, the station does offer customer help points for inquiries. Although staff help at the station isn't provided, you can reach out to the Customer Service Centre at 0345 6000 650.
Accessibility at Millbrook (Hants) may present a challenge for those requiring step-free access, as the station is categorized as having no such facility. However, there are ramps for train access, and assistance can be arranged with the train guards for boarding and alighting. It is advisable to book assistance up to two hours before your journey when traveling with South Western Railway, although impromptu requests can be managed on-site. While there are no accessible toilets or waiting areas, you can make use of the public Wi-Fi to stay connected during your wait.
Transport links to and from the station are straightforward. A rail replacement service is available, with buses stopping outside the station on the slip road from Waterloo Road to Mountbatten Way (A33) for travel to Totton/Romsey, or on Mountbatten Way by Lakelands Drive for journeys heading towards Southampton. For planning ahead, downloadable bus route information is available from National Rail.
